    My understanding is the battery is 7.4 v
    so you stand a good chance of hurting it with 11.1 v

    yes the cheaper driver boards do not have any reverse polarity protection
    so again a good chance of destruction
    you need a multimeter and check polarity of the battery .

    I am guessing you mean Fermenting in the keg to carbonate
    May be a leak and all the CO2 has escaped
    you could try adding another 70 grams of sugar for a 2nd 2nd ferment
    mate had this happen and it worked a treat he did put a new washer on the keg
    Overtightening is a common fault with the pressure barrels
